Support for Optional Devices

Optional devices are available to expand the capabilities of the 2420 telephone. They include:

20A Stand—Every 2420 telephone comes equipped with a convertible stand that allows you to install the 2420 telephone on your desktop or on a wall. You must replace this convertible stand with the 20A stand if you are using a 200A or 201A module.

200A Module Analog (U.S.) Adjunct Interface—This module provides standard tip/ring capabilities, allowing you to connect analog devices (such as a fax machine) to the 2420 telephone.

201A Module Recorder Interface—This module allows you to record telephone conversations. In addition, this module allows you to use two additional headsets via the jacks on the 20A stand.

EU24 Expansion Module—This module can display up to 24 additional call appearance/feature buttons that have been programmed for your call processing system. Buttons are displayed in two columns, with one column displayed at a time on the EU24 screen.

For more information, see the documents that are included with each device.

Safety Information

Your 2420 telephone has been manufactured according to industry standards for quality and safety assurance. When using your telephone, follow recommended safety precautions to reduce the risk of fire, electric shock, and personal injury. See the 2420 Installation and Safety Instructions that were packaged with your telephone.
